Business description (provided by the business owner):

Loving home environment with a small group. Fun activities and healthy snacks. Over 20 yrs combined experience, run by Two Loving Moms dedicated to providing your child with a fun creative learning atmosphere. CPR certified with flexible hours. State registered with reasonable rates and block grants accepted.
